The Rhythms of the Night: Exploring MC Marcinho's 'Catucar'

MC Marcinho's song 'Catucar' is a vibrant and energetic piece that captures the essence of Brazilian funk music, known as 'funk carioca.' The lyrics are filled with playful and suggestive language, reflecting the genre's characteristic blend of rhythm, dance, and street culture. The repeated phrase 'vou catucar' can be interpreted as a metaphor for engaging in a lively and intimate dance, emphasizing the physical and sensual connection between the dancers.

The song paints a vivid picture of a night out in the favelas, where the protagonist, MC Marcinho, describes his adventures and interactions at a funk party. The lyrics mention 'subir o morro pra curtir um baile funk,' which translates to 'climbing the hill to enjoy a funk party,' highlighting the cultural significance of these gatherings in the communities of Rio de Janeiro. The reference to 'batem cabeça' and 'ficar à vontade na marola' suggests a carefree and immersive experience, where people come together to dance and enjoy the music.

MC Marcinho also touches on themes of confidence and charisma, portraying himself as a seasoned participant in the funk scene. He uses terms like 'nego xiba tipo A' and 'nego madeira' to describe his persona, indicating a sense of pride and authenticity. The playful and flirtatious tone of the song, combined with its rhythmic beats, creates an atmosphere of celebration and enjoyment, inviting listeners to join in the fun and embrace the lively spirit of funk carioca.
